What is the difference between #import and #include in Objective-C?
...which you want to use. I tend to #import headers for Objective-C things (like class definitions and such) and #include standard C stuff that I need. For example, one of my source files might look like this:
#import <Foundation/Foundation.h>
#include <asl.h>
#include <mach/mach.h>...

What is %2C in a URL?
...
Check out http://www.asciitable.com/
Look at the Hx, (Hex) column; 2C maps to ,
Any unusual encoding can be checked this way
